Transaction 0ec64fe77b38cf961d6dfb0d53278b631b4a6ce19718e6da9ed22508dc508702
1 Input
1 Output
-
0ec64fe77b38cf961d6dfb0d53278b631b4a6ce19718e6da9ed22508dc508702:0
- value
- 2745674
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ba20d18dcd366ce4ad8b21351a748cea60722127 OP_EQUAL
- address
- 3JfAvVryCd634Ltqh1o1LN3SSZ9qchpbjC